What it is: A portable, reproducible benchmark for evaluating AI reliability across:
- Adversarial Fact Verification (AFV)
- Multi-Step Tool-Augmented Reasoning (MSR)
- Constrained Policy Generation (CPG)
Why it matters: It measures determinism, hallucination, source selection, constraint adherence, fairness, and recovery — the pillars of governed cognition.

How to use:
- Run the harness:
python run_harness.py --tasks tasks.jsonl --runs 10 --out results.jsonl - Score:
python score_results.py --tasks tasks.jsonl --results results.jsonl --out scores.json - (Optional) Recovery demo:
python run_harness_recovery.py --tasks tasks.jsonl --simulate_errors - Review CI artifacts for a quick sanity check
